ductus venosus
http://purl.obolibrary.org/obo/UBERON_0002083

The vascular channel in the fetus passing through the liver and joining the umbilical vein with the inferior vena cava.

Ductus venosus naturally closes during the first week of life in most full-term neonates; however, it may take much longer to close in pre-term neonates. Functional closure occurs within minutes of birth. Structural closure in term babies occurs within 3 to 7 days. After it closes, the remnant is known as ligamentum venosum
